You are volunteering for a local nonprofit organization whose mission is to improve child literacy. This organization has asked for your help gathering information on the reading activities that local children engage in.
1. For each of the following scenarios, state the null and alternative hypotheses.
Scenario A: You read in a report that preschool-aged children have on average 5.2 books at home. You are concerned that children in your community have fewer books.
Scenario B: The nonprofit recently engaged in a campaign to encourage elementary school children to read more. A previous study found that children in your community read in their free time for 48 minutes per day on average. You would like to find out whether the time spent reading among elementary school students increased after the campaign.
Scenario C: Your local public library reported last year that the average number of children visiting the library each day was 77. You would like to test whether that has changed.
